Transaction 5398639c91d11f333bbf0dd7a4c0537e38ececf2809922e4dfa8afe3af514dd0

2 Input
2 Outputs
  • 5398639c91d11f333bbf0dd7a4c0537e38ececf2809922e4dfa8afe3af514dd0:0
  • value  678308
    address  1KGc7cVww5JyJPSGbAXnEso8LsNR3LA8Rd
  • 5398639c91d11f333bbf0dd7a4c0537e38ececf2809922e4dfa8afe3af514dd0:1
  • value  1149311
    address  1CturYoosvKqdnEDTSjhQL8JHGLnhYrF4i